Adds the ability to "Sign in with PagerDuty."
- Download the latest release in Maven or GitHub.
- Install the plugin by copying the JAR file to
/opt/keycloak/providers/
. See Server Developer Guide.
Use one of the following endpoints to download the JAR plugin in your CI/Build:
https://search.maven.org/remotecontent?filepath=com/arthuryidi/provider/pagerduty-identity-provider-keycloak/<version>/pagerduty-identity-provider-keycloak-<version>.jar
https://github.com/pdt-ayidi/pagerduty-identity-provider-keycloak/releases/download/v<version>/pagerduty-identity-provider-<version>.jar
If you are using Keycloak's Docker distribution, modify the Dockerfile and use the ADD
command to download the plugin:
ADD --chown=keycloak <https://...jar> /opt/keycloak/providers/
./gradlew signMavenPublication
./gradlew publishToSonatype closeAndReleaseSonatypeStagingRepository
Project not sponsored by PagerDuty.